Transaction 3a6625eccce5138a9be7fd94f76fbf5df83129cb705bcb830f1d51a2597e3913
1 Input
1 Output
-
3a6625eccce5138a9be7fd94f76fbf5df83129cb705bcb830f1d51a2597e3913:0
- value
- 280158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7f17c1c0d935320bca761e56b3244baf1d6fcb4 OP_EQUAL
- address
- 3QJ27aqH67ubh5zsGAMR7mx8dCvfCTcriF